Output 26695bd25ebd8fe0782f32183d94e810befbddd6209bcded95b4dbc827f1aa85:0

value
110350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11825d83a852e5df46f5ec1207ed459cca790bed OP_EQUAL
address
33Hbak7AhXLCjnYNYvDhH1BeKW6Uq4qTAX
transaction
26695bd25ebd8fe0782f32183d94e810befbddd6209bcded95b4dbc827f1aa85
confirmations
153655
spent
true